2b. The cord must be UL listed, CSA labelled, and consist of three conductors
with a maximum of 15 feet in length. Type SVT or SJT cord sets shall be
used for units which stand on a desk or table. Type SJT cord sets shall be
used for units which stand on floor.

2c. The male plug for units operating at 115 VAC shall consist of a parallel
blade, grounding type attachment plug rated 15 A, 125 VAC.
The male plug for units operating at 230 VAC shall consist of a tandem
blade, grounding type attachment plug rated 15 A, 250 VAC.
The male plug for units operating at 230 VAC (outside of the United States
and Canada) shall consist of a grounding type attachment plug rated 15 A,
250 VAC and have the appropriate safety approvals for the country in which
the equipment will be installed.

Caution: Support the CrossFire 8600 Token-Ring Switch and/or the CrossFire
8605 Token-Ring Fiber Switch while you are installing the unit to avoid dropping
it on the floor or any equipment beneath it in the rack. The CrossFire 8600 Token-
Ring Switch unit and the CrossFire 8605 Token-Ring Fiber Switch unit each
weighs approximately 8.8 kg (19.4 lbs).

Caution: To separate the switch from the power, pull the power cord completely
out from the socket. The power socket must be easily accessible and located near
the unit.

Warning: All RJ-45 connectors must only be connected to safety extra low voltage
(SELV) circuits like local area networking (LAN).

Warning: This product relies on the building’s installation for short-circuit
(overcurrent) protection. Ensure that a fuse or circuit breaker no larger than
120 VAC, 15A U.S. (240 VAC, 10A international) is used on the phase conductors
(all current-carrying conductors).

Warning: A voltage mismatch can cause equipment damage and may pose a fire
hazard. If the voltage indicated on the label is different from the power outlet
voltage, do not connect the chassis to that receptacle.

Caution: If you are using the redundant power supply unit CrossFire 8311 note that
this unit is not hot-swappable. Both the CrossFire 8311 unit and the switch must
be off before connecting or disconnecting the DC power cable.
